well, i would definetly recommend extra memory, the one that comes with it is 32 mb i belive, and id keep that pretty much for just saved games, and to update your psp version to 2.60 wich takes 18 mb. Getting your extra memory will allow you to have plenty of space for mp3s, pictures, and videos if you get a big enough stick. As for games, all depends on what kind of games you like, same with movies for that matter. Casings, well i would definetly look into getting a hard case, thats alot of money your going to be carrying around, and possibly a screen protector.
